全站数据
8 4 2 0 5 8 1

学嵌入式的话c语言要学到什么程度

小李说教师招考 | 教育先行,筑梦人生!         
问题更新日期:2024-06-06 06:23:43

问题描述

学嵌入式的话c语言要学到什么程度,麻烦给回复
精选答案
最佳答案

学习嵌入式开发,C语言是必须要掌握的编程语言。

以下是学习嵌入式开发所需掌握的C语言内容:

1. 基本语法:掌握C语言的基本语法,包括变量、数据类型、运算符、控制语句和函数等。

2. 指针和内存管理:了解指针的概念和使用方法,掌握动态内存管理的函数,如malloc()和free()。

3. 数据结构与算法:熟悉常用的数据结构,例如数组、链表、栈和队列,以及常见的排序和查找算法。

4. 文件操作:了解文件的打开、读写和关闭操作,掌握文件指针的使用方法。

5. 位操作:了解位操作符的使用方法,掌握位运算的基本原理和常见的位操作技巧。

6. 嵌入式系统编程:学习如何编写嵌入式系统的驱动程序、中断处理函数和定时器等。

7. 掌握低级编程:学习如何直接访问硬件资源和寄存器,编写底层驱动程序。

8. 调试技巧:学习使用调试工具,如GDB和JTAG,掌握调试技巧和常见的调试方法。总之,学习嵌入式开发需要对C语言有深入的理解和熟练的掌握,包括基本语法、指针和内存管理、数据结构和算法以及嵌入式系统编程等。这些基础知识能够帮助你在嵌入式领域进行开发和调试。